Higher Education Funding Council (HEFCE) data places Birmingham in the 12 elite institutions in England. The University is one of the best performing institutions which share more than half of students with the highest A-level grades.

The data, which is available on the HEFCE website, gives the number and proportion of top students admitted to each university in 2009/10. These data demonstrate that the highest number of AAB students attend Birmingham, Bristol, Cambridge, Durham, Exeter, Leeds, Manchester, Nottingham, Oxford, Sheffield, Southampton and Warwick; forming an elite English ‘Ivy League’.
